RoHS, the environment regulation announced by European Union, restricts the use of lead, mercury, cadmium, hexavalent chromium, PBB, and PBDE in products put on the market in The European Union after July 1, 2006.
Correct Disposal of This Product (Waste Electrical & Electronic Equipment)
(Applicable in the European Union and other European countries with separate collection systems)
This marking shown on the product or its literature, indicates that it should not be disposed with other household wastes at the end of its working life. To prevent possible harm to the environment or human health from uncontrolled waste disposal, plea se separate this from other types of wastes and recycle it responsibly to promote the sustainable reuse of material resources.
Household users should contact either the retailer where they purchased this product, or their local government office, for details of where and how they can take this item for environmentally safe recycling.
Business users should contact their supplier and check the terms and conditions of the purchase contract. This product should not be mixed with other commercial wastes for disposal.

Checking USB 2.0
In order to use this drive at the speed of USB2.0 on PCs not supporting USB 2.0, you need to install USB 2.0 adapter card. Otherwise, this drive will operate by connecting USB 1.1, but within the speed range of USB 1.1. You can check the type of USB 2.0 adapter card for your PC as follows.
Windows 2000/XP
Right-click on My Computer icon on your desktop and select properties. Then, click on Hardware tab and Device Manager Button in order, and then check the information. If a yellow “exclamation point” appears next to Universal Serial Bus Controller, contact the card or PC manufacturer.

DVD Region Protection Coding (RPC):
The RPC feature is supported on DVD players and is used with DVD-video discs (such as movies). Currently, the motionpicture industry has divided the worldinto different regions or zones thatcorrespond to the regional markets intowhich the motion picture industry releasesmovies. Simply put, RPC codes are placedon movies marketed throughout the world,based on the region of the world inwhich they are being sold. These RPCcodes help control and prevent piratingof new movies into other motion pictureregions prior to their true releasedates within those markets. The SE-T084L External DVD Writer supports RPCphase II. In the RPC-2 mode, the localcode can be changed by users. RPC-2is selected by default for the SE-T084L External DVD Writer. You can change the region code up tofive times via an MPEG application.
Please contact your dealer or local SAMSUNG representative if you wish tochange the local code more than fivetimes.

External DVD Writer record data on the disc by applying laser light onto the surface of the CD DVD, and therefore writing errors may occur if you use a damaged CD DVD , for example . Be sure to eliminate the following error-causing elements before you start writing: * The following settings are recommended for all External DVD Writer:
Avoid a situation that requires multitasking , and remove turn off the screen saver.
A buffer underrun may occur if the system multitasks while the External DVD Writer CD-RW drive is writing/erasing.
Block any outside attempt to access the host PC during a writing session.
An error may occur if another user accesses the printer connected to his/her the system via the network during a writing session.
Disable the CD auto - run feature of the CD
Inserting an auto - run-enabled CD in to another drive connected to the same system during a writing/erasing session may cause an error.
GO to Start Settings Control Panel System Hardware Device Manger CD- ROM Settings . Disable Insert AutoRun.
It is recommended that you use the image file format when you write a large number of small­sized files.
When there are a large number of small-sized files to write , the system's transmission rate drops and the Superlink feature works at a more frequent rate, resulting in lower writing quality.
If you are doing a CD-to-CD write , it is not necessary to check to see if you have available space on your hard disc beforehand.
.
However, in the case of image files, it is recommended that you be sure you have at least twice the amount of space needed for the data on your hard disc , as image files are copied to the hard disc before they are copied to the CD.
Do not use more than one type of writing software.
Before you install a writing program, be sure to first uninstall existing version s of the prog ram or other writing program ( s ) and reboot the system first .
(The Windows operating system may be damaged if you install the Korean version while the English version remains on the system.)
Use only the writing software provided by Samsung. You may experience writing errors if you use with other writing programs
T he disc has bad properties data , and or there are other discs with different prope rties available under the same ID.
The drive's write strategy is set in a way that the drive examines to examine the disc properties and determine s the optimal write conditions for those properties.
For example, many disc makers do not bother to insert property information distinguishing 48X disc s from 32X disc s . Since the two types of discs have the same properties data , although they actually have different properties, it is often impossible to respond to the situation with a single write strategy. In order to ensure stable writing , it is necessary to downgrade the write speed.
If discs from two different disc makers have the same write speed according to the labels , but actually have different write speed s , I i t is necessary to downgrade the write speed to ensure stable writing.
